Practical Font Pairing Strategies for Marketing Templates
Mirum, Slab Serif, and Fonts offer versatile pairing opportunities that can elevate any design template. In my workflow, I found that Mirum works beautifully when contrasted with a lightweight geometric sans serif. This combination creates a dynamic tension between the sturdy, grounded feel of the slab serif and the airy, modern vibe of the sans serif. For more traditional or editorial-style campaigns, pairing Mirum with a classic serif font can evoke a sense of heritage and reliability. However, avoid pairing it with another slab serif, as this can create visual clutter and reduce readability. When designing Pinterest pins or webinar promotional graphics, keep the pairing simple. Let Mirum handle the heavy lifting for titles and subheadings, while using a neutral font for supporting information. This strategy ensures that the key message remains the hero of the design, supported by a typography system that enhances rather than distracts.
